Overview#
The Gillette PR-2400 is a 240-kilowatt prime-rated natural gas generator on PSI's 14.6L turbocharged V8 — the same engine platform as the SP-3500 standby (350 kW). At 240 kW prime (362 bhp), the engine operates well within its thermal design limits for unlimited continuous duty. Three-phase only, Stamford S4L1DD alternator, DSE 7420 MKII controller.
Standby to prime: the SP-3500 and PR-2400 relationship#
The PSI 14.6L V8 demonstrates the standby-to-prime derating pattern:
- SP-3500: 350 kW standby (536 bhp) — limited annual hours
- PR-2400: 240 kW prime (362 bhp) — unlimited continuous duty
The 31% derating ensures engine longevity under sustained load. For facilities that need continuous power at 200+ kW on natural gas, the PR-2400 is the appropriate specification.
Our service experience#
The PSI 14.6L at continuous duty requires 8-cylinder ignition service at 1000-hour intervals — approximately every 6 weeks at 24/7 operation. We structure PR-2400 maintenance as multi-technician service events to complete the 8-cylinder ignition, oil, and air filter service efficiently within a planned maintenance window.
